GameStop Shares Surge on Record Operating Income and Revenue Beat

Key Facts

1GameStop reported Q2 revenue beats and record operating income.
2The company provided updated fiscal 2026 guidance.

In a move reflecting the resilience of the retail sector against economic headwinds, GameStop shares are trading higher following strong quarterly performance. According to reports, the company delivered a revenue beat for the second quarter, underpinned by record operating income. This surge is directly linked to these financial surprises which outperformed initial market estimates.

Beyond the quarterly figures, GameStop provided an optimistic update to its fiscal 2026 guidance. Per analyst data, the upward revision of full-year expectations has been a primary catalyst for the stock's positive price action. Investors are increasingly focusing on the company's ability to maintain record operating efficiency as a sign of long-term stability.
